Very helpful book
I dabbled as a henna artist for a couple years, and I appreciate seeing this instruction in a format for drawing, because I could never draw the designs I made in henna. The book is well laid out, with 4-step directions breaking down each mandala into parts that make sense. The circular graph makes it easy to replicate each drawing. I appreciate that the graphs are drawn with proportions specific to each mandala. I was able to translate these skills into other art, such as watercolor (line and wash).The quotes provided with each mandala add some meaning and inspiration as you work through the tutorials.Don’t let the simplicity of this book deter you from purchasing it. The beauty and effectiveness lie in this simplicity. I recommend it for anyone who loves mandalas but feels intimidated by the idea of drawing their own. Great gift!

Great book if you want to draw Mandalas
I was happily surprised with this book for making pretty complex mandalas in a simple way. I own most mandala books and I think I like this one the best to show how to actually draw it.Each mandala is shown on one whole page.Then it has a demonstration page that breaks down the mandala into 1/4 of a circle segments, laid out in a mandala grid.There are 4 steps shown.In Step 1, what you are supposed to draw in the mandala grid is shown in black ink.In the Step 2 section; what you previously drew in step 1 is changed to a grey ink, with the new steps to draw shown in black ink.Then it continues to demonstrate each step in the same format, what was previously drawn shown in grey, then what you are to draw next in black.Beside the page showing all the steps, is a blank grid in grey ink for you to draw your mandala. So you can see what you are supposed to draw beside where you actually draw in the book.It seems a very smart way to break down complex mandalas. If you drew all 20 designs, you would probably have a lot of ideas from the practices to launch off on drawing your own mandala designs.It is all visual demonstration, with only a small amount of text on the first page only.But it’s very inspiring to pick up a pen and give it a go.
